NeoCortec is deepening its industry footprint not just as a distribution partner, but by teaming up with Endrich Bauelemente Vertriebs GmbH to power their e-IoT platform with NeoMesh, its ultra-low-power, highly scalable wireless mesh networking protocol and software stack.

Endrich’s e-IoT platform helps industrial customers digitize their operations, offering everything from IoT nodes and smart sensors to gateway devices and Cloud services.
NeoMesh is built for exactly this kind of application, smart sensor networks where devices send and receive small data packets infrequently, but need to do so with rock-solid reliability.
The protocol is optimized for ultra-low power consumption, making it ideal for battery-powered networks with dozens or even thousands of nodes.
In real-world deployments, NeoMesh enables these networks to run on small batteries for years without replacement.
What sets NeoMesh apart from most other mesh technologies is its dynamic, scalable architecture.
It handles thousands of nodes with minimal limits on network size or depth, and it’s self-healing, if a node goes down, the system automatically reroutes the signal without interrupting the network.
Endrich’s e-IoT platform brings this capability to life through a diverse range of smart sensor solutions:
- Citybox 2.0for smart city applications (environmental monitoring, transportation, infrastructure), including air quality and traffic noise sensing, plus brightness control nodes for streetlamps
- Elevator monitoring systemfor real-time performance tracking
- NeoMesh cellular gatewaysthat connect NeoMesh smart sensor nodes with prepaid cellular connectivity
- Digital and analog NeoMesh smart sensor nodesfor temperature, humidity, ambient light, door opening, and AC voltage presence detection
- Soil sensorsmeasuring moisture and nutrient levels for precision agriculture
- RS485 DIN-rail-mounted IoT NeoMesh gatewayfor refrigerator temperature control
- Dataloggers for refrigerationthat continuously monitor temperature and operational parameters to ensure food safety, energy efficiency, and regulatory compliance
- Cellular dataloggersseamlessly integrated into refrigerator door lightbars, tracking door-opening events, temperature, and humidity
- e-zeroBatteryZone, enabling maintenance-free IoT systems without any batteries by combining energy harvesting with ultra-low-power design
